Investigating How CagriSema, Semaglutide and Cagrilintide Regulate Insulin Effects in the Body of People With Type 2 Diabetes

What it studies

Condition

  • Diabetes Mellitus, Type 2

Interventions

  • Drug: Semaglutide
  • Drug: Cagrilintide
  • Drug: Placebo semaglutide
  • Drug: Placebo cagrilintide

Primary outcome

what the primary-completion date above is the date OF
To compare the effect of CagriSema versus placebo: Change in M-value in hyperinsulinaemic euglycaemic clamp (HEC)
measured Baseline to week 28
